Jordan’s sites of antiquity are straight out of an archaeologist’s wildest dream, including fabled Petra, long-lost city of the Nabateans, Jerash, a fabulously preserved Roman city, and the great Crusader castle at Kerak. The ancient legacy of Jordan is rivaled only by the stunning beauty of the landscape, from the dramatic desert canyon of Wadi Rum, haunt of T.E. Lawrence, to the legendary Dead Sea. This Private Journey is a comfortable one, with 5-star hotels, private English-speaking guides, air-conditioned vehicles, and lots of wonderful interaction with the Jordanians, among the most hospitable people in the world.

Visit the striking Roman ruins at Jerash, an archaeological masterpiece framed by the hills of Gilead, and the impressive Al Rabad Castle, built in defense against the Crusaders, then journey to a luxury spa on the Dead Sea to enjoy the therapeutic secrets of its legendary waters.
En route to Petra, explore the great Crusader fortress at Kerak. This monumental building soars above its surroundings and is filled with galleries and secret passageways. Its thick defensive walls are pierced by narrow arrow slits where Crusader archers held out. Continue to Petra, “a rose-red city half as old as time” and one of the great treasures of the ancient world. Petra’s stunning desert setting is unequaled and its elaborately carved temples, hewn into the cliffs by the mysterious Nabatean people 2,000 years ago, are spell-binding.
This was Lawrence of Arabia’s headquarters during World War I, and he named his book, The Seven Pillars of Wisdom, after Wadi Rum’s natural landmark of seven jagged rock columns. Explore the canyon by 4WD and enjoy dinner served under Bedouin tents before returning to Petra.
In the tranquil haven of Aqaba, swim and snorkel along pristine coral reefs in the Red Sea. Return to Amman on Day 10, with an afternoon to explore its Roman theater, art galleries, and the bazaars of the Gold Market. Depart on Day 11.
